Who's on board with Caesar Sunday? I love the versatility of a good Caesar. You can use vodka, gin, tequila, mezcal, or simply omit the booze for a delicious dry January option. I like mine spicy and a bit smokey, so I use our Morita + Espresso + Chipotle hot sauce and add candied jalapenos to the garnish.

Inspired by my friend Peggy at @frostbitesfun, here’s a little flashback Friday. It’s good to look back every once in a while and be reminded just how far we’ve come. 1. OG jars, labels, no logo & even a different company name. 2. My very first set up at the Saturday market - Easter 2012. I wasn’t even in the main market but on a path to the washrooms. 3. Candied Jalapeños have been around since almost the very beginning. ... 4. My first kitchen that was my very own. It’s an in-law suite above my garage. Cute but not very practical. All the raw ingredients (fruit, sugar, jars) went up a flight of stairs, and all jam had to come back down a flight of stairs. It was also dangerous hot in the summer. See more
